Abstract. Abstract. Cone crushers are used by both the aggregate producing and the mining industry. Both industries are interested in increasing the product quality while at the same time lowering the production costs. Prediction of crusher performance has been focused on, since crushing is a vital process for both industries.

· Check whether the oil pump, cooler and filter work well. The scavenge oil must be lower than 60℃. Check the drain of the water seal. If there is no water in the water seal, the crusher must stop running. Pay attention to the sound of engine and gear, and check whether the working current of the motor is normal.

· A cone crusher punishes itself in every minute of operation. It squeezes a dense mass between heavy castings until the mass disintegrates. It abrades and minces aggregate until the material yields to the applied forces. It rumbles and vibrates and bangs as its core shaft spins eccentrically to capture and reduce chunks of aggregate.

· Process optimization. 1. Crusher design evolution. Compression cone crusher designs today have evolved from the simple cone crusher first developed in the mid-1920s by Edgar B. Symons, to the modern high performance crushers. Early crushers used springs for tramp iron protection and were manually adjusted.
